as posted by the channelThis is a debate on the existence of God between Mike Jones and Dr. Richard Carrier. Mike presents arguments for theism through idealism, the emergent universe argument, and the moral argument, asserting that a theistic explanation is more plausible and parsimonious in explaining various aspects of reality such as consciousness, morality, and the universe's emergence. Dr. Richard Carrier defends naturalism, arguing that the explanation through a 'bubble' or nothingness leading to an infinite multiverse is simpler, more likely, and fits better with our observed reality. The debate delves into complex philosophical and scientific concepts, addressing the nature of consciousness, the possibility of a multiverse, the hard problem of consciousness, and the plausibility of moral realism.
The session concludes with audience questions and closing arguments, offering a comprehensive discussion on the existence of God.
